Subject: On-call heads-up — Orchardly catalog cache. Welcome aboard. The main gotcha: catalog price updates invalidate by SKU, but bundle pages cache composite keys, so a stale bundle can outlive its parts. If support reports wrong bundle prices, purge the composite namespace first. We'll cover this at the weekly sync; the invalidation playbook is on this internal page.

wiki page, yagef-tawif: https://sentry.lumicdata.local/view/merge_requests/pipeline/merge_requests/e08f7f35c80b5755

Subject: Key rotation — PayGate test harness

Team,

Rotating the internal mock-ledger key today. Suspect the flaky integration tests in PayGate stem from the old key intermittently hitting rate limits after last month's quota change. New key has a dedicated test quota. Update your local env before tomorrow's run; CI is already switched. Flag remaining flakes at the sync. New key follows.

gateway credential: kto3_qfe

Handover Note — For the Board

As I pass the Solvane launch to Marta Keel, a quick summary: pricing is locked, the pilot in Greybourne went smoothly, and distribution through Ardent Mills Retail is contracted for autumn. The one loose end is the training rollout for the Ferndale sales team — Marta, that's yours first. Otherwise the plan is in good shape and I'm confident in the timeline. Our fuller strategic intentions for the launch are captured in the note below.

management briefing: Jorixax Holdings is in early talks to buy Casixax Holdings for about $420.3 million. The Fenmir launch date is October 27, and nothing goes to the press before then. Legal wants the Keloxek Foods term sheet redrafted before April 16.

## Limits and Quotas: Image Slimming

The Torvane build farm enforces hard ceilings on slimmed container images before promotion. Layers over the cap are rejected at the Larkspur gate, not warned. Releases exceeding the aggregate quota must file a waiver with platform ops. Current enforcement values are defined in code and reproduced below.

limits module of fajog-tawig:
RATE_LIMITS = {
    "druwyn": 2,
    "quenael": 10,
    "wenix": 2,
    "druael": 2,
}